Bifold Door Glass Replacement Cost: A Comprehensive Guide
Bifold doors are a popular choice for house owners wanting to enhance area and add a touch of sophistication to their homes. These doors are particularly beneficial for creating flexible home, such as in between a living space and a dining area, or for sliding glass patio doors. However, like any other home component, bifold doors can suffer damage, specifically to their glass panels. Understanding the cost of bifold door glass replacement is essential for house owners who wish to preserve their doors efficiently. This post provides a comprehensive breakdown of the aspects that affect the cost of bifold door glass replacement, along with some frequently asked questions to assist you make a notified choice.
Factors Affecting Bifold Door Glass Replacement Cost
Type of Glass
Standard Glass: The most cost effective choice, standard glass is normally utilized in bifold doors. It is available in different thicknesses, with 3mm and 4mm being the most common.Tempered Glass: Tempered glass is four times stronger than basic glass and is more resistant to breakage. It is a safer choice and frequently required in areas where security is a concern, such as near a bathtub or in a kid's space.Laminated Glass: Laminated glass consists of two or more layers of glass bonded together with a plastic interlayer. It is highly resistant to damage and is often used in locations where security and sound reduction are essential.Frosted or Etched Glass: These kinds of glass are used for privacy and visual purposes. They are more expensive than basic glass however can include a special touch to your Bifold door restoration doors.
Size of the Glass Panel
The size of the glass panel is a significant element in identifying the cost. Larger panels will naturally be more pricey due to the increased quantity of product required. Determining the dimensions of the broken panel precisely is essential to guarantee a proper fit.
Labor Costs
The cost of labor can vary depending on your place and the intricacy of the job. Expert glaziers or door installers typically charge by the hour, and the time required to replace the glass can range from a few hours to a full day, depending upon the size and type of glass.
Extra Materials
Replacing the glass may need extra materials such as sealants, gaskets, and hardware. These expenses can add up, so it's essential to factor them into your budget plan.
Do it yourself vs. Professional Installation
While some homeowners may choose to replace the glass themselves to save cash, it is frequently suggested to hire a professional, particularly for larger or more intricate tasks. Specialists have the experience and tools to guarantee the job is done correctly and safely.Typical Cost BreakdownStandard Glass: ₤ 20 to ₤ 50 per square footTempered Glass: ₤ 50 to ₤ 100 per square footLaminated Glass: ₤ 70 to ₤ 150 per square footFrosted or Etched Glass: ₤ 100 to ₤ 200 per square footLabor Costs: ₤ 50 to ₤ 100 per hourExtra Materials: ₤ 20 to ₤ 50Steps to Replace Bifold Door GlassProcedure the Panel: Accurately measure the measurements of the broken glass panel. This will guarantee that the brand-new glass fits perfectly.Eliminate the Old Glass: Carefully get rid of the broken glass panel. Utilize an energy knife to cut away any sealant or adhesive holding the glass in place.Prepare the Frame: Clean the frame and use a brand-new layer of sealant or gasket to guarantee a tight fit.Install the New Glass: Carefully put the brand-new glass panel into the frame. Guarantee it is centered and safe and secure.Secure the Glass: Use clips or screws to protect the glass in location. Apply extra sealant if required.Evaluate the Door: Open and close the bifold door to make sure the new glass panel is correctly set up and the door operates smoothly.FAQs
Q: Can I replace the glass in a bifold door myself?
A: While it is possible to replace the glass yourself, it is recommended to work with a professional, specifically for bigger or more complicated tasks. Specialists have the experience and tools to make sure the job is done correctly and safely.
Q: How much does it cost to replace the glass in a bifold door?
A: The expense can differ depending upon the kind of glass, size of the panel, and labor expenses. On average, the expense varieties from ₤ 100 to ₤ 500 for a basic glass panel, with additional expenses for tempered, laminated, or frosted glass.
Q: What type of glass is best for bifold doors?
A: Tempered glass is a popular choice for bifold doors due to its strength and safety functions. Nevertheless, the very best type of glass depends on your particular requirements, such as privacy, security, and visual choices.
Q: How long does it take to replace the glass in a bifold door?
A: The time required can differ, however a specialist can usually finish the job in a couple of hours to a full day, depending on the size and intricacy of the glass panel.
Q: Can I use a various kind of glass than what was originally installed?
A: Yes, you can use a various kind of glass, but it is necessary to guarantee that the brand-new glass fits appropriately and meets any safety or structure code requirements.
